Strengthening Bhutan-India Relations: A New Era of Cooperation

In a recent speech, Prime Minister Tshering Tobgay of Bhutan expressed heartfelt appreciation for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i, whom he described as both a mentor and an elder brother. This acknowledgment highlights the long-standing cultural and past connections that bind the two nations. Tobgay’s comments reflect the significant role Modi has played in enhancing bilateral relations, particularly as both leaders address the complexities of regional dynamics and economic advancement. This article explores Tobgay’s insights, the implications of their partnership, and ongoing initiatives aimed at fostering connectivity and prosperity between Bhutan and India.

Bhutan PM Highlights Strengthened Ties Under Modi’s Guidance

In his remarks, Prime Minister Tobgay conveyed deep gratitude towards Prime Minister Modi for his pivotal role in fortifying ties between Bhutan and India. He noted that under Modi’s stewardship, their partnership has thrived across various sectors. Key areas of collaboration include:

  • Infrastructure Development: Projects aimed at improving connectivity and modernization.
  • Trade Enhancement: Initiatives designed to strengthen economic links for mutual benefit.
  • Cultural Exchange Programs: Efforts to deepen people-to-people connections that promote understanding.

Tobgay emphasized that Modi’s leadership has established a solid groundwork for future cooperation. By referring to him as a mentor and elder brother, he acknowledged India’s genuine commitment to supporting Bhutan’s developmental aspirations. This sentiment is reflected in several key projects advancing various sectors within Bhutan, paving a prosperous path characterized by mutual respect and shared goals.

The Significance of Joint Initiatives in Strengthening Bhutan-India Relations

The collaborative efforts between Bhutan and India have substantially reinforced their enduring friendship, showcasing the profound ties connecting these two nations. Under Prime Minister Tobgay’s leadership, this relationship has evolved notably through enhanced economic cooperation, cultural exchanges, and infrastructure projects. Noteworthy initiatives such as the Hydropower Development Agreement, along with cross-border trade facilitation measures have further cemented trust between them—demonstrating not only an intent to boost economic growth but also fostering a spirit of collaboration beyond political affiliations.

Diplomatic discussions have consistently been vital in maintaining harmony between both countries.Platforms like the Bilateral Joint Committee serve as essential venues for addressing key issues collaboratively while promoting regional stability through focused dialogues on:

  • Cultural Diplomacy: Engaging programs celebrating each nation’s heritage.
  • Sustainability Initiatives: Collaborative efforts addressing climate change challenges through conservation practices.
  • Agricultural Infrastructure Projects: Investments aimed at enhancing transportation networks to improve connectivity.

This proactive approach reflects not just shared interests but also mutual development aspirations—illustrating an evolving narrative centered on respectful collaboration among both nations.
